Korpse Konsole EP
Posted 14 years agoSome of you may have noticed I've been producing more stuff under the alias "Korpse Konsole".
The genres I've been focusing on are aggressive sounds of Hardcore, Drum and Bass, and Drumstep, generally anything in the 165-175 BPM region. I've finally decided that I will be leaking some information on the new EP coming out soon.
The working title is "You Deserved This", which will feature some awesome heavy tracks, some of which are already available via my Soundcloud, and showcased here on FA. A special surprise track is also in production as tribute to my #1 idol here in the fandom. <3
Hope this will get some buzz going, cus I definitely could use some. Also, tomorrow's my 1 Year since I've been on FA, and what better way to celebrate is to get to spin for a bunch of furries at a party!!
Details on THAT: http://www.furaffinity.net/journal/2824064/
Love you all and more to come (like FINALLY?) soon!

Occupy Baltimore
Posted 14 years agoRaverfox and I went down to the Occupy Baltimore meeting last night, and about 300 people showed up. At the drop of a motorcycle helmet, we all raised about $600 towards the campaign, and decided to start occupying Baltimore as soon as Tuesday Evening.
Follow up meeting tonight, but participation is looking to be quite large starting out, and we hope for it to grow more and more! ;3
